About The Position

The Coordinator I - Benefits Specialist serves as a key member of the district leadership team, responsible for the comprehensive administration, compliance, and strategic oversight of all employee benefit programs within the District. This position ensures the effective delivery and communication of benefits including medical, dental, vision, life insurance, disability, fringe benefits, retirement systems, and wellness initiatives. The Benefits Specialist coordinates enrollment, eligibility, and claims processes while maintaining strict adherence to federal, state, and local regulations, including ERISA, HIPAA, FMLA, the Affordable Care Act (ACA), and relevant provisions of the Illinois School Code. In addition to program administration, the incumbent provides direct support to employees regarding benefits inquiries and concerns, facilitates onboarding and open enrollment processes, and maintains accurate records in the District's Human Resources and Finance Information Systems. This role collaborates with payroll and finance team members to ensure accurate deductions, reporting, and benefits-related journal entries, while supporting internal audits and compliance reviews. The Benefits Specialist is also responsible for analyzing benefits utilization and costs, preparing detailed reports to support budgeting and collective bargaining, and recommending enhancements aligned with best practices and industry benchmarks. The position further oversees employee retirement contributions (e.g., IMRF, TRS, 403(b), 457 plans), manages COBRA and workers' compensation processes, and coordinates wellness programs and educational outreach to promote employee well-being and engagement. This position requires a high level of confidentiality, attention to detail, and the ability to interpret and apply complex regulatory requirements while delivering exceptional service to District employees.

Responsibilities

  • Administer and oversee all employee benefits programs including medical, dental, vision, life, short- and long-term disability, fringe benefits, and retirement plans.
  • Manage state retirement systems, including enrollment, counseling, and documentation for the Illinois Municipal Retirement Fund (IMRF) and the Teachers' Retirement System (TRS).
  • Coordinate administration of COBRA, ensuring federal compliance in coverage transitions.
  • Administer workers' compensation claims in collaboration with third-party administrators and carriers.
  • Process benefits terminations and transitions due to separations, retirements, or leaves of absence.
  • Act as liaison to state-level benefits agencies (e.g., School Employees Benefits Board), ensuring adherence to state-specific policies.
  • Coordinate and track employee leave usage and accruals, including FMLA, disability, and personal leave, while ensuring accurate documentation and legal compliance.
  • Calculate and monitor reimbursements owed to the District for benefits-related payments from employees on leave, COBRA participants, and retirees.
  • Coordinate and deliver annual open enrollment processes, ensuring timely communication and support for employees throughout.
  • Ensure full compliance with federal, state, and local benefits laws and regulations.
  • Prepare and submit mandated reports, such as salary and benefits surveys to ISBE.
  • Maintain accurate, up-to-date records in the Human Resources Information System (HRIS), ensuring integration with payroll, time tracking, and third-party vendor systems.
  • Serve as the primary point of contact for employee inquiries regarding benefit enrollment, changes, claims, and eligibility.
  • Analyze the usage, cost, and effectiveness of benefits programs; make data-informed recommendations for improvements or plan changes.
  • Coordinate employee wellness initiatives, campaigns, and events to support staff health and well-being.
